Monument to the heroes of Pleven

Monument to the heroes of Pleven

Сountry: Russia

Locality: Moscow

Nearest metro station: Kitay-gorod

Established: 1887

Sculptor: Sherwood V.O.

Engineer: Lyashkin A.I.

 

Description

Monument to the heroes of PlevenThe monument in honor of Russian grenadiers who were killed in the battle of Bulgarian city Pleven when Russian army liberated the city from Turkish aggressors it is a small octahedral chapel. There are reliefs on the chapel: Turkish soldier is snatching out a child from the Bulgarian mother`s hands; The grenadier who is taking prisoner of the Turkish soldier; The father is blessing the son to the march; The Russian soldier is removing a chain from the woman which is a symbol of Bulgaria. On the conical roof there are memorial inscriptions. On the top of the roof there is a cupola which looks like a Monomakh`s Cap with the Orthodox cross on the top.

Creation history

The chapel was established in 1887 in 10th anniversary of the battle of Pleven. The sculptor Sherwood V.O and the engineer Lyashkin A.I. became the authors of the monument. The money was collected by the grenadiers who also fought in that battle of Pleven in honor of the killed comrades. On the solemn ceremony were many official persons including official persons from Bulgaria. Every year in the chapel organized the requiem for the killed Russian grenadiers in the battle of Pleven against of the Ottoman Empire and who gave the freedom to the brotherly people.

How to find

Go to the metro station Kitay-gorod of the Tagansko-Krasnopresnenskaya Line and exit to the square Ilyinsky Gate next to the entrance to the Ilyinsky square. Here next to the metro you will find the monument to the heroes of Pleven.
